FREDERICTON -- Academic staff at the University of New Brunswick have set a strike deadline.

The bargaining committee of the Association of University of New Brunswick Teachers has voted unanimously on a strike deadline of 12:01 a.m. Monday.

The union represents about 800 full-time and contract academic staff, librarians and researchers.

They work in Fredericton, Saint John, Moncton and Bathurst.

Wages and workload are the main issues for the association.

Their contract expired June 30.
